Output 39e7ddb2b0c1760ffbe19c0eaa7f9f94c358e5963d238beee512b1d1d6fe7fd8:0

value
7112606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 121567d64b937b5c3da2213e5991eb40006f2d79 OP_EQUAL
address
33LdjHUMdvy2864h9ZfEYfsx1XW9ogfUBF
transaction
39e7ddb2b0c1760ffbe19c0eaa7f9f94c358e5963d238beee512b1d1d6fe7fd8
spent
true